Jund Regulates Gene Dynamics in Endothelial-to-Hematopoietic Transition

IO_AdminUncategorized2 months ago66 Views

Quick Summary

  • The Proceedings of the National Academy of Sciences published research in Volume 122, June 2025, focusing on transcription factors (TFs).
  • The study investigates the relationship between TF binding and cis-regulatory elements (such as enhancers) in influencing gene expression during cell fate transitions.
  • Enhancer activity and its regulatory role regarding TF interactions remain a complex and unresolved aspect of genetic expression processes.
